如何在NSSString中指定heart character?我正在实施网络协议,并希望将其作为心跳发送。
这是来自角色查看器的Unicode信息:
Unicode: U+1F493 (U+D83D U+DC93), UTF-8: F0 9F 92 93
答案 0 :(得分:3)
最简单的方法是直接在Xcode中输入一个字符串常量:
NSString *heart = @"";
如果您需要将其转换为特定编码中的字节,请使用NSData
,如下所示:
// Specify the encoding that you need
NSData* heartData = [heart dataUsingEncoding:NSUTF8StringEncoding];
如果有NSData
个实例,您可以访问其bytes
和length
以复制到心跳消息中。